ICC ODI World Cup 2023: Rohit’s seventh century and Bumrah’s dangerous bowling have brought India’s excellent performance into the limelight. Sharma has brought his record performance into the limelight in the match played between India and Afghanistan.

Rohit Became The Batsman To Score Most Centuries in the WC:-

Sharma has scored a brilliant century in 63 balls in this match. With this century, Rohit has become the batsman who has scored the most centuries in the World Cup.

He has left Sachin Tendulkar behind in this record. Before this century, both Rohit and Sachin were tied on scoring 6 centuries, but now Rohit has scored 7 centuries in the World Cup.

Earlier This Record was in The Name Of Kapil Dev:-

Apart from this, Rohit has also scored the fastest century for India in the World Cup. Earlier this record was in the name of Kapil Dev, he had scored a century in the World Cup in 72 balls. Now Rohit has scored a century in just 63 balls.

Rohit Sharma has played 19 matches scoring 7 centuries. At the same time, Sachin Tendulkar has played 6-century innings in 45 matches. It is clear from this that Rohit has a unique record in the World Cup. There is more than double the difference in playing World Cup matches between Sachin and Rohit.

But Rohit has still left Sachin Tendulkar behind in terms of scoring most centuries. Sharma has made many records in his name in yesterday’s match.

Rohit Has Left Chris Gayle Behind in The Race For Sixes:-

Sharma has also made the record of hitting the most number of sixes in ODI cricket. Rohit has left Chris Gayle behind in the sixes race, Gayle had hit 553 sixes.

Let us tell you that Jasprit Bumrah has also played 11 matches in the ODI World Cup so far. A total of 24 wickets have been registered in his name. This is his second World Cup.

In the year 2019, he took 18 wickets in 9 matches. This season he has taken 6 wickets in two matches. His economy in this tournament has been 4.27.
